Transaction 106211770a16fa4f670b7b64474506972816c60cbe40748cdb2f9ae7b112ec60
1 Input
2 Outputs
- 106211770a16fa4f670b7b64474506972816c60cbe40748cdb2f9ae7b112ec60:0
- 106211770a16fa4f670b7b64474506972816c60cbe40748cdb2f9ae7b112ec60:1
value 2569422
address 116CRNHrBx2cZzefkx9VPKV62782xu6dQ4
value 72825786
address 172S35Bm6MGxXRFUWokeH3MoXYjHWExvZr